IHU 120-hour TESOL Course

IHU TESOL team, as a part of Ibn Haldun University, is a group of professional trainers with many years of experience and reliable qualifications. 120-hour TESOL course is designed and delivered by the team both face-to-face on the IHU Campus and online. The certificate is approved by The Council of Higher Education (YÖK) in Turkey which can pave the way for finding a job in the countries such as it.

FAQs

These are the most frequent questions about IHU TESOL course

1.     WHO IS ELIGIBLE FOR TESOL COURSE?

People with no previous teaching experience - the course provides you with the basic tools and techniques you will need for teaching English as a foreign language people with some teaching experience - although the course is a pre-service course, we have many applicants who have some classroom experience. For those people, the TESOL helps to refine some of the teaching skills they already have as well as introducing them to new ideas and techniques.

2.     WHAT KIND OF PROGRAMMES ARE AVAILABLE?

Full-time face-to-face courses - Fridays, Saturdays - all day (5 weeks)

Full-time online courses - (10 days)

3.     HOW MANY CERTIFICATES DO I RECEIVE AT THE END OF THE COURSE?

2. One of them is your TESOL certificate from Ibn Haldun University with your grade. The other one is the band descriptor.

4.     CAN I FIND A TEACHING JOB IN OTHER COUNTRIES WITH THIS CERTIFICATE?

Definitely yes. But don't forget this is ONE of the qualifications. Some organizations need some post-certificate experience. So, it is highly recommended to do the course in your earliest convenience.

5.     IS THERE ANY FAIL IN THE COURSE?

The course is fully developmental and we try to help all candidates to pass with high scores but there are for sure some standards candidates should meet.

6.     WHAT DO ASSIGNEMENTS INVOLVE?

It involves general and focused observations, final exam and teaching practice.

7.     WHAT DOES IN-CLASS MODULE INVOLVE?

Although it can be tailor-made for different groups of candidates, it has some basics including teaching skills and subskills, classroom management, and the like.

8.     HOW OFTEN IS TESOL COURSE HELD?

Four times a year.
